Aziz Sancar (US), Tomas Lindahl (United Kingdom) and Paul Modrich (US) have jointly won 2015 Nobel Prize in Chemistry.They has been chosen for their research on mechanistic studies of DNA (deoxyribonucleic acid) repair by Royal Swedish Academy of Sciences .
Their work has given application of living cell for the development of new cancer treatments and fundamental knowledge of functioning of living cell functions .
Aziz Sancar: He is from the University of North Carolina, US.He has mapped Nucleotide Excision Repair (NER) which is the mechanism in which cells repair Ultra Violet (UV) damage to DNA.
Tomas Lindahl: He is from the Francis Crick Institute,London .He has successfully demonstrated that DNA decays at a rate that ought to have made the evolution of life on Earth impossible.
Paul Modrich: He has successfully demonstrated how the cell corrects wrongs that occur when DNA is replicated during cell division. He is from the Howard Hughes Medical Institute and Duke University School of Medicine, UK.
